Akamai Technologies, Inc. $AKAM Shares Purchased by First Horizon Corp

First Horizon Corp raised its stake in Akamai Technologies, Inc. (NASDAQ:AKAMFree Report) by 12.6% during the 4th quarter, according to its most recent Form 13F fil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ission. The fund owned 154,910 shares of the technology infrastructure company’s stock after purchasing an additional 17,274 shares during the period. First Horizon Corp’s holdings in Akamai Technologies were worth $13,516,000 as of its most recent SEC filing.

Akamai Technologies Price Performance

Shares of NASDAQ:AKAM opened at $95.89 on Friday. Akamai Technologies, Inc. has a one year low of $69.78 and a one year high of $121.12. The stock has a market capitalization of $13.91 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of 31.13, a PEG ratio of 3.32 and a beta of 0.59. The company has a 50-day simple moving average of $105.38 and a 200-day simple moving average of $92.40.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.82, a quick ratio of 2.36 and a current ratio of 2.36.

Akamai Technologies (NASDAQ:AKAMGet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ings results on Thursday, February 19th. The technology infrastructure company reported $1.84 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, topping analysts’ consensus estimates of $1.75 by $0.09. The firm had revenue of $1.09 billion for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$1.08 billion. Akamai Technologies had a return on equity of 13.86% and a net margin of 10.74%.The business’s revenue was up 7.4% on a year-over-year basis. During the same quarter last year, the company posted $1.66 earnings per share. Akamai Technologies has set its FY 2026 guidance at 6.200-7.200 EPS and its Q1 2026 guidance at 1.500-1.670 EPS. On average, analysts predict that Akamai Technologies, Inc. will post 4.6 EPS for the current year.

Akamai Technologies Profile

(Free Report)

Akamai Technologies, Inc is a leading provider of content delivery network (CDN) services and cloud security solutions designed to optimize and safeguard digital experiences. Leveraging a globally distributed platform, the company accelerates web and mobile content delivery for enterprises, media companies, e-commerce platforms and government agencies. Its edge computing architecture brings processing power closer to end users, reducing latency and improving application performance across geographies.

The company’s core offerings include content acceleration, web and mobile performance optimization, media delivery, and a suite of cybersecurity solutions that protect against DDoS attacks, application-layer threats and bot-driven fraud.
